
Step 1: Set Up Your Files
First, you need two blank text files. Create one and call it index.html. Create another and call it styles.css. These files will hold all the code for your website.
Step 2: Get Code from ChatGPT
Now, open up ChatGPT. Tell it you need help building a website. You can ask it to act like a skilled web developer. Ask for the structure of a landing page. You can even specify what the website is for, like a burger place.

Step 3: Add Code to Your Files
Open your index.html file in a text editor. Paste the HTML code from ChatGPT into this file and save it.
Next, open your styles.css file. Paste the CSS code from ChatGPT into this file and save it.
Step 4: Repeat for Other Sections
Go back to ChatGPT and repeat step 2 and 3 for the next part of your website, like the hero section. Keep doing this for each section you need based on the structure you got earlier.
Step 5: Add Images with AI
Websites look better with pictures. You can use AI art tools to create background images or logos for your site. Generate the images you need.
Save the image files to a folder. It’s helpful to give the image files simple names that match what the code might expect. ChatGPT can often give you instructions on how to link these images in the code.

Step 6: Refine and Complete
Check your website in a web browser to see how it looks as you add sections. It might not be perfect right away. You may need to add small pieces of CSS code to improve the appearance. The key is to keep going section by section until your website is finished.
